Enjoy one of the three major Edo-style sushi casually and deliciously
In the heart of Shinbashi, Tokyo, despite being in a bustling area, the shop has only 7 seats and one table (4 seats). In this limited space, you can enjoy the owner's exquisite skills and classical Edo-style sushi.
The sushi prepared by the owner is large-sized classical Edo-style sushi, and its appearance and taste leave an unforgettable impact after just one bite.
